WATCH) Pam Bondi Explodes On Adam Schiff Mid-Hearing, Calls Out His Prior Censure

The confirmation hearing for Attorney General nominee Pam Bondi commenced as a standard procedure but quickly transformed into a heated debate with Senator Adam Schiff (D-CA). During the exchange, Bondi highlighted Schiff’s previous censure by Congress. Schiff inquired about Bondi’s hypothetical handling of cases and her stance on pardons, leading to an increasingly charged atmosphere. Central to their disagreement was Schiff’s inquiry into potential investigations and the management of presidential pardons.
